Canvassing of Voters in Campaigns

THE PARTY OR campaign canvass is one of the oldest, and, historically, least technologically sophisticated, forms of voter mobilization. Modern campaigns conduct much more complex, more sophisticated canvassing operations, but contemporary canvasses are still true to the same core ...
